FM 3 … WebSep 17, 2024 · Signal Squad — To signal the squad, face the squad leader and extend your hand and arm toward the squad leader, with the palm down. Move your hand up and down until the squad leader acknowledges the command. Turn Right (From the Pilots Point of View) With left arm and wand extended at a 90° angle to the body, right hand makes the come ahead signal. The rate of signal motion indicates to the pilot the rate of aircraft movement desired.
